As the third generation of Ragozzino Foods, Hamden Hall alumni and siblings Amy Ragozzino Lawless 1995 and Joe Ragozzino 2001 understand the ins-and-outs of the food industry. Their grandparents, Joe and Anna Ragozzino, established the Meriden-based Italian cuisine food company in 1952 after tasting canned spaghetti sauce that a salesman was peddling to them for their small grocery store.
